Transaction 1e9931039bdc784bc50feef93b3278db7081ef826e23f87d0c37091808f6e892
1 Input
1 Output
-
1e9931039bdc784bc50feef93b3278db7081ef826e23f87d0c37091808f6e892:0
- value
- 486086
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ab6a3677b8211b6c01f7ba3df0a01b73e304c817
- address
- bc1q4d4rvaacyydkcq0hhg7lpgqmw03sfjqh0tt7jd